A father speaking about his gay son inspired a standing ovation at the weekend’s ALP state conference.
Peter Moore, of Burnie, spoke about his youngest son, Robbie, to lend support to a motion for marriage equality.
Mr Moore, 67, said two years ago he would never had stood up to speak in support of the motion.
“I grew up on the North-West Coast. I have a wife and four children …and six years ago my youngest son came and said: `I’m gay’, and you could have knocked me over with a feather.
